1. Heating System Sort

The kind of heating system chosen considerably impacts the general value of sustaining a desired pool temperature. Totally different techniques make the most of various power sources and applied sciences, leading to a spread of value factors for each set up and operation. Choosing the suitable system requires cautious consideration of local weather, pool dimension, finances, and desired heating efficiency.

  • Fuel Heaters

    Fuel heaters supply fast heating and are efficient in numerous climates. They make the most of pure gasoline or propane, offering constant warmth output even in cooler temperatures. Nonetheless, they usually have larger working prices in comparison with different techniques because of the value of gasoline. A home-owner in a colder local weather prioritizing fast heating may select a gasoline heater regardless of the upper working prices.

  • Warmth Pumps

    Warmth pumps extract warmth from the encompassing air and switch it to the pool water. They’re energy-efficient, particularly in milder climates, leading to decrease working prices in comparison with gasoline heaters. Nonetheless, their heating capability may be affected by cooler air temperatures. A home-owner in a average local weather centered on power effectivity would seemingly go for a warmth pump.

  • Photo voltaic Heaters

    Photo voltaic heaters use daylight to heat the pool water, making them essentially the most environmentally pleasant and cost-effective choice in areas with ample sunshine. Nonetheless, their efficiency depends on climate circumstances they usually require a major preliminary funding. A home-owner in a sunny local weather searching for to reduce environmental impression and long-term prices would seemingly select photo voltaic heating.

  • Electrical Resistance Heaters

    Electrical resistance heaters use electrical energy to immediately warmth the water. Whereas they’re simple to put in and function, they’re usually the most costly choice to run because of the excessive value of electrical energy. They’re usually most popular for smaller swimming pools or spas the place fast heating is desired and working prices are much less of a priority.

The preliminary funding and operational prices related to every heating system kind range significantly. Evaluating these components alongside particular person wants and priorities is essential for choosing essentially the most cost-effective and appropriate heating resolution for a selected pool and local weather.

6. Insulation and Covers

Insulation and covers play a vital position in minimizing warmth loss and, consequently, decreasing pool heating prices. Correct insulation prevents warmth from escaping by the pool’s partitions and flooring, whereas covers decrease evaporation, the first supply of warmth loss in swimming pools. This mixed method considerably improves heating effectivity, permitting the heating system to function much less regularly and eat much less power. For instance, a well-insulated pool with a high-quality cowl can retain warmth considerably longer than an uninsulated pool and not using a cowl, resulting in substantial financial savings on power payments. The effectiveness of insulation and covers in decreasing warmth loss interprets immediately into decrease working prices and a extra sustainable method to pool heating.

Numerous varieties of pool insulation can be found, every providing completely different ranges of thermal resistance. Spray foam insulation offers a excessive stage of insulation, successfully minimizing warmth switch by the pool shell. Fiberglass insulation presents one other efficient resolution, notably for brand spanking new pool development. Vinyl liners with insulating properties can even contribute to warmth retention. Choosing the suitable insulation materials depends upon components reminiscent of pool development, finances, and desired stage of thermal efficiency. Equally, several types of pool covers supply various levels of insulation and evaporation management. Photo voltaic covers, for instance, not solely scale back evaporation but in addition take in photo voltaic radiation, passively heating the pool water. Computerized covers present handy operation and enhanced insulation. Choosing the proper mixture of insulation and canopy supplies maximizes power effectivity and minimizes operational bills.

Query 5: What’s the typical lifespan of a pool heater?

Heater lifespan varies relying on the kind of heater, utilization patterns, and upkeep practices. Fuel heaters usually final 5-10 years, whereas warmth pumps can final 10-20 years with correct upkeep. Common upkeep and well timed part substitute contribute considerably to maximizing heater lifespan.

Tip 1: Put money into a Excessive-High quality Pool Cowl

Pool covers considerably scale back warmth loss by evaporation, the first supply of warmth loss in swimming pools. A well-fitted cowl can scale back warmth loss by as much as 70%, leading to substantial power financial savings. Computerized covers supply handy operation and enhanced insulation, whereas photo voltaic covers present extra passive heating advantages.
